About the Role
Sidney Senior Village is seeking Maintenance Technicians to advance better living and care for seniors in a 41-unit apartment community.
Responsibilities
- Perform routine and preventive maintenance on HVAC, plumbing, electrical, and building systems.
- Diagnose and repair maintenance issues in a timely manner.
- Maintain interior and exterior common areas, ensuring safety and cleanliness.
- Complete minor carpentry, painting, appliance, and general repairs.
- Supervise and mentor junior maintenance staff, when applicable.
- Manage inventory and submit maintenance records and reports.
- Comply with all safety regulations and building codes.
Requirements
- High school diploma or equivalent required; technical/vocational training preferred
- 1-2 years of residential or apartment maintenance experience required
- Skilled in HVAC, plumbing, electrical, carpentry, and general repairs
- Excellent troubleshooting and communication skills
- Relevant certifications (HVAC, OSHA, etc.) a plus
- Valid driver's license required
- Availability for on-call duties 24/7, including evenings, weekends, and holidays, to respond to maintenance emergencies as needed.
